A new rugged integrated AC/DC converter with optimised input current
This paper presents a power factor-corrected AC/DC power converter derived from the integration of a nonisolated buck-boost AC/DC converter with an isolated dual active bridge DC/DC converter. It has high line voltage surge immunity. A novel modulation strategy has been developed which optimises the ratings required of the power devices.
